Double hashing visualization python. double num = 5; That avoids a cast. Dec 31, 2021 · I've read about the difference between double precision and single precision. to use negative infinity) in a C(++) program? DBL_MIN in float. h is the smallest positive number. Floating-point formats often have an interval where the exponent cannot get any smaller, but the significand (fraction portion of the number) is allowed to get smaller until it reaches zero. int to double is a widening conversion. 2: Widening primitive conversions do not lose information about the overall magnitude of a numeric value. Jun 29, 2009 · Double is a good combination of precision and simplicty for a lot of calculations. However, in most cases, float and double seem to be interchangeable, i. 79769•10 308. Feb 16, 2009 · In my earlier question I was printing a double using cout that got rounded when I wasn't expecting it. Dec 31, 2021 · I've read about the difference between double precision and single precision. g. You can create a very high precision number with decimal -- up to 136-bit -- but you also have to be careful that you define your precision and scale correctly so that it can contain all your intermediate calculations to the necessary number of digits. std::numeric_limits<T>::min() is the smallest positive normal value. 1. [] Conversion of an int or a long value to float, or of a long value to double, may result in Jul 20, 2009 · Is there a standard and/or portable way to represent the smallest negative value (e. How can I make cout print a double using full precision? Feb 28, 2013 · So my conditioning has always been to utilize html codes as a practice for content creation. e. I was just curious as to why there needs to be 3 different ways to code a double quotes in html codes, for example. You don't have to guess, just check the JLS. . But you'll find that the cast conversions are well-defined. 1415926535 这个数字,如果用float来表示,最多只能精确到小数点后面的6位。而double大约能精确到小数点后面的15位左右。具体精确到几位,跟所用的 编译器 Apr 22, 2015 · Possible Duplicate: long double vs double I am new to programming and I am unable to understand the difference between between long double and double in C and C++. Feb 6, 2018 · For double, this is 2 1024 −2 971, approximately 1. using one or the other does not seem to affec C语言中,float和double都属于 浮点数。区别在于:double所表示的范围,整数部分范围大于float,小数部分,精度也高于float。 举个例子: 圆周率 3. From §5. I tried to Google it but was unab Format %lf in printf was not supported in old (pre-C99) versions of C language, which created superficial "inconsistency" between format specifiers for double in printf and scanf. ypjzz pzajj yrtdeo xmps wrkvjjo cxhnyk vwgsn yqi kgfxq xrqk